template struct cv::cudev::LargerType

#include <type_traits.hpp>

template <
    typename A,
    typename B
    >
struct LargerType
{
    // typedefs

    typedef SelectIf<unsigned(VecTraits<A>::cn) !=unsigned(VecTraits<B>::cn), void, typename MakeVec<typename type_traits_detail::LargerDepth<typename VecTraits<A>::elem_type, typename VecTraits<B>::elem_type>::type, VecTraits<A>::cn>::type>::type type;
};